qos download is actually fixed and the same as 3.18 now.

802.11r is appearing to be working, hostapd started, its showing in beacon info. 802.11w still kills radios though.

a few of our auto hostapd config entries are improved but many are still bad or seemingly missing from its compilation.

included tickets are only those affecting r7800 and kong build only.

cpu temp fixed

r37630 commit didnt fix ticket 5279.

wpa3 any combo of it, now radios doesnt broadcast at all.

802.11r is fixed and working EXCEPT one missed hostapd config entry, or it doesnt work and breaks roaming. we are missing ft_psk_generate_local=1 on both radios, without it roaming is sticky on all devices, usually dont roam at all and just drop, when they do try to roam, they have to do the 4 way handshake every time. here is openwrt commit of it https://patchwork.ozlabs.org/patch/916119/ below is a log output with ft_psk_generate_local=1 added:

EDIT:
I did have a bit of trouble with its ovpn server. Log showed bunch of:
..... write UDPv4: Message too large (code=90)
Client connected would basically quit resolving anything.

I changed its ovpn server port to TCP but client would not even connect.
Disabled its 'Tunnel UDP MSS-Fix' and that was no good either.
Made some changes on the client but no luck so I set everything back to the way I
normally run an just done a soft reboot of the EA8500. It is now all working great.
Have no ideal why problem after first install.....
I reckon likely because I just installed over BS_r37736 and it got a bit confused
all is fine now Razz

I discovered after a couple of hours that the WiFi is not working in this build and I was trying all sorts of things.
I decided to reset the nvram and it was working but as soon as I set my settings back manually it stopped again. Turns out VHT80 and VHT160 are both broken.
Then I put my nvram back and to my surprise the ath1 was completely gone. This was only fixed after a reboot.

So in terms of WiFi this build is actually broken.
